Problem
Users of household appliances face difficulties in resetting operating parameters after incorrect operation, often forgetting the adjusted values and dealing with multiple changes that complicate the resetting process.
Innovation Solution
Incorporating a reset control element that allows operators to easily revert to original settings by actuating a dedicated button or switch, with options for resetting single or multiple changes, including time-dependent and state-specific configurations, to simplify the resetting process without needing to remember the adjusted values.

The household appliance (1, G) is equipped with at least one control element (4, 5a-d, 6a-d, 7-12) for modifying at least one operating parameter of the household appliance (1, G), the household appliance (1, G) further comprising a reset control element (13), which is provided for resetting at least one most recently carried out modification. A method is used for operating a household appliance (1, G), wherein at least one most recently carried out modification of an operating parameter can be reset by an operator.
